Output 51aedac8c6ef918c985ec3342172c741b7b0434a0d815250114f745305489b6e:0

value
541985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 590c848a4f4606266e88e1bc2411ca00e48948dd OP_EQUAL
address
39os4N5K2T2JNeyqtqdZdDAzgHHdvBWqut
transaction
51aedac8c6ef918c985ec3342172c741b7b0434a0d815250114f745305489b6e
spent
true